Your cart is empty.Raybestos Drum Brake Wheel Cylinders are built for a long service life and feature the highest-quality components, delivering top-of-the-line performance and safety. High-quality rubber components offer superior resistance to heat and corrosion and ensure a long service life. With an OE design to ensure proper fit, function and safety, these drum brake wheel cylinders deliver consistent, safe and reliable performance.

Bought these brake cylinders when I replaced the shoes, springs, and drums on my 2000 Ford Taurus LX. They went right on and came with new bleeders but bought the Dorman Speedy bleeders so I could bleed the brakes by myself. BTW, if you're doing all the brakes it's a good time to change and flush the fluid. I ended up having my daughter help me bleed them the old fashioned way. Think I must have gotten a lot of air in the system when I changed the fluid. Used a quart plus about half a pint to flush and bleed the system.
